Episode 162: Healthy Winter Immune Systems are Built in Autumn

Today Jess is talking about immunity, and why it is important to support your child's immune system before winter.
Parents generally focus on building their children's immunity during winter. However, focusing on supporting your children's (and your) immune system in autumn gives you the best chance of fighting off colds, and flu when winter time approaches.
In this episode, Jess will discuss:

  • How the immune system develops as a child ages;
  • The different parts of the immune system;
  • How innate immunity and adaptive immunity work together;
  • The normal symptoms of illness and how often it is normal to be sick;
  • How to determine if your child has a healthy immune system
